#831393 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#831393 is composed of 51.4% red, 7.5%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.9% cyan, 87.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 292.5 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 32.5%. #831393 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ff26ff with #070027.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#831393 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#831393 has RGB values of R:131, G:19,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 8590227.

Shades and Tints of #831393

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070108 is the darkest color, while #fdf6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#831393

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535353 is the less saturated color, while #8d06a0 is the most saturated one.
